Biography/Administrative History
The Teagues and Hardisons are pioneer families in Santa Paula. Teague built the Limoneira company a major producer of citrus
in the area, Harrison was a co-founder of Union Oil, a large producer of oil in the area. The families were prominent in
business, banking, real estate as well.
Scope and Content of Collection
There are several handwritten notes about the members of the Teague and Harrison families and some family "trees". There
are also news clippings about the two families and one Memorial Service booklet for Charles Collins Teague
